Mamata Banerjee slams Centre for death of Indian student in Ukraine

West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ee criticised the Centre for the death of an Indian student in Ukraine. The Indian student was killed in Russian shelling in Kharkiv.

West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ee on Wednesday slammed the Centre for the death of an Indian student in Ukraine shelling and called it 'government negligence'.

"This is negligence. Negligence is a crime. It takes a couple of phone calls to do all these, how much time would it take from political rallies," she said.

Mamta Banerjee said, "I have supported PM Modi on Ukraine. But I have a question if PM knew about such a thing three months back. Why were these Indian students not brought back? It is the responsibility of any government to bring them back."

Earlier, the Trinamool Congress chief had extended her support to Prime Minister Narendra Modi for the evacuation of Indian citizens from Ukraine, following the Russian invasion.

"I don't want to criticise the government in matters of external affairs. We are one. But because they are busy in politics, things did not happen," she alleged.

She also slammed the ministers, who are being sent to Ukraine's neighbouring countries to facilitate evacuation, by stating that the civil aviation minister gave a speech after landing in Romania. Banerjee said the PM sends his ministers to give speeches and do politics.
